What role does The Hood play in the episode 'Endgame'?

In 'Endgame', The Hood is the central antagonist who orchestrates a plan to take down International Rescue. He uses his cunning and manipulative nature to exploit the vulnerabilities of the Tracy family and their operations.

How does Scott Tracy's leadership come into play during the crisis in 'Endgame'?

Scott Tracy steps up as the leader of International Rescue, showcasing his determination and strategic thinking. He coordinates the team's efforts to counter The Hood's threats, demonstrating his commitment to protecting his family and the world.

What challenges do the Thunderbirds face while trying to thwart The Hood's plan?

The Thunderbirds face multiple challenges, including navigating through dangerous environments and dealing with The Hood's advanced technology. Each Thunderbird is put to the test, requiring teamwork and quick thinking to overcome obstacles.

How does Virgil Tracy's character develop in 'Endgame'?

Virgil Tracy shows significant growth in 'Endgame' as he grapples with the pressure of the mission and his responsibilities. His emotional state fluctuates between determination and doubt, but ultimately he proves his bravery and skill in the face of danger.

What emotional stakes are present for the Tracy family in this episode?

The emotional stakes are high for the Tracy family as they confront the threat posed by The Hood. Each member feels the weight of their legacy and the fear of losing one another, which adds depth to their motivations and actions throughout the episode.
